Lead AI Autonomous Systems and Robotics Engineer
1 week ago
We are seeking a highly skilled Lead AI Autonomous Systems and Robotics Engineer to join our team at The MITRE Corporation. As a key member of our Artificial Intelligence and Autonomy Innovation Center, you will play a critical role in developing cutting-edge autonomous systems, robotics capabilities, and AI solutions for a safer world.
Key Responsibilities- Maintain knowledge of advances in autonomy and robotics capabilities in industry and academia
- Leverage technical expertise to evaluate and improve AI/Autonomy system performance
- Provide thought and team leadership centered around autonomy/AI technology adoption on robotics hardware and cloud-based computing environments
- Develop, propose, and lead research in the field of autonomy and AI
- Evaluate autonomy or AI solutions and provide guidance to sponsors based on their requirements
- Work on topics in robotics-relevant fields, such as computer vision, deep learning, machine learning, planning, human machine teaming, and multi-robot systems
- Build a team, capabilities, and work program in one or more growth areas for Autonomous Systems
- Help department and division execute strategy around enabling high-consequence applications of Autonomy, including necessary assurance, T&E, and societal implications
- Typically requires a minimum of 8 years of related experience with a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Engineering Physics, Systems Engineering, Computer Science, or Software Engineering, or similar field; or 6 years and a Master's degree; or a PhD with 3 years' experience; or equivalent combination of related education and work experience
- Must be a U.S. citizen with ability to obtain and maintain a DoD Secret clearance
- Understand the breadth of autonomous systems across different domains (DoD, Services, Intelligence Community, DHS, Industry and Academia)
- Experience in robotics-relevant fields, such as computer vision, deep learning, machine learning, planning, human machine teaming, and multi-robot systems
- Ability to articulate autonomy-specific challenges (in perception, reasoning, behaviors, collaborations), discuss critical issues, and identify gaps
- Familiarity with the state of the art in the field
- Knowledge of the challenges of developing autonomous and AI systems that are robust in real-world scenarios
- Proficiency in use of Microsoft Office including Outlook, Excel, and Word
- Must have demonstrated proficiency and strength in verbal, written, PC, presentation, and communications skills
- Proven ability to work independently to learn new technologies, techniques, processes, languages, platforms, systems
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ills along with the ability to foster relationship development with sponsors
- Advanced degree in technical field of study
- Experience leading either technical or project teams, or serving as a group direct supervisor
- Practical knowledge of simulation environments for AI/autonomous systems
- Understanding of the Federal Government, specifically with relation to AI and Autonomy interests, missions, and organizations
- Active DoD Secret Clearance
MITRE is a not-for-profit corporation chartered to work for the public interest, with no commercial conflicts to influence what we do. We are a diverse and dynamic team united by a passion to catalyze consequential use of Artificial Intelligence (AI). We collaboratively work across government, industry, and academia to address complex AI and Autonomy challenges for the benefit of our nation.
We offer competitive benefits, exceptional professional development opportunities, and a culture of innovation that embraces diversity, inclusion, flexibility, collaboration, and career growth.
